WebApr 11, 2024 · Yet, some simple maths can help you compare. Take the rate on the ISA you're looking at and multiply it by: - 1.25 if you're a basic-rate taxpayer ... To work out what rate a normal fixed savings account would have to pay to beat an ISA, take the ISA rate and multiply it by 1.25 (if you're a basic-rate taxpayer), 1.66 (higher-rate taxpayer) or ...

WebApr 12, 2024 · This is also known as a ‘split loan', or split interest rate, where interest is charged at a fixed rate on part of your mortgage principal and at a variable rate on the remainder. It doesn’t have to be 50/50 fixed and variable, but may be 80% fixed, 20% variable, or whatever the borrower and lender agree on. A split rate home loan may offer ...
